How to Choose the Right Curtains for Your Home
Choosing curtains is not just a matter of color and pattern. The right curtains can enhance the look of a space, provide comfort, and control lighting and privacy in your home. Each space has a different function, so choosing curtains also needs to be tailored so that the results are more harmonious and practical.
1. Living Room – Focus on Style and Lighting
The living room is the main area for receiving guests. Choose curtains that look elegant and match the home decoration concept, whether modern, minimalist, or classic.
If the living room is small, use bright colors such as white, cream, or pastel to give the illusion of space. For spaces that receive bright sunlight, you can use a combination of sheer and blackout so that the lighting is more controlled.
2. Bedroom – Prioritize Privacy and Comfort
For bedrooms, the main function of curtains is to block light and provide maximum privacy. Blackout curtains are perfect for sleeping better without the distraction of outside light.
Choose soft and soothing colors such as soft blue, light gray, or nude to create a relaxing atmosphere.
3. Kitchen – Simple and Easy to Maintain
Kitchen curtains need to be practical and easy to wash because they are exposed to smoke and oil. Avoid thick fabrics. It is best to choose light materials such as cotton or sheer that do not easily trap odors.
Simple designs such as roman blinds are also suitable for small kitchen spaces.
4. Children's Room – Cheerful and Safe
For children's rooms, choose cheerful colors and patterns. However, make sure the fabric is safe and not too long to avoid the risk of getting caught or pulled.
The combination of patterned curtains with blackout layers also helps children sleep more comfortably during the day.
5. Workspace – Control Light Glare
For work spaces at home, curtains function to reduce the glare of light on the computer screen. Choose neutral colors and not too bright so that focus is not disturbed.
Blinds or dim-out curtains can also be a practical option.
Conclusion
Choosing the right curtains according to the home space helps create a more comfortable, neat and harmonious atmosphere. By choosing the right fabric, color and design, every space not only looks more beautiful, but is also more practical for daily use.
